About This Deck

The Pop Art Tarot Cards deck by Cinderly offers a fresh, modern interpretation of the iconic Rider-Waite-Smith (RWS) tarot system. It draws direct inspiration from Pamela Colman Smith's classic 1909 illustrations, maintaining the foundational symbolism and composition that RWS readers are familiar with. The key distinction lies in its aesthetic transformation, applying a pop art filter to the traditional artwork.

This deck is designed to appeal to both long-time tarot enthusiasts and newcomers who appreciate a contemporary visual style. By retaining the core RWS imagery, it ensures that the deck remains highly readable and compatible with existing RWS guidebooks and interpretations. The pop art treatment, characterized by its bold color choices and simplified forms, gives the deck a distinctive and energetic presence, making it a unique addition to any collection.

The campaign, launched in 2024, successfully raised $7,133 from 50 backers, indicating a strong interest in this modern take on a classic. While specific card count and material details are not provided in the campaign story, the visual evidence confirms it is a standard tarot deck. The emphasis is clearly on the visual refresh, offering a vibrant and accessible entry point into the world of tarot through familiar yet revitalized imagery.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is the Pop Art Tarot a Rider-Waite-Smith (RWS) deck?
Yes, the Pop Art Tarot is directly inspired by Pamela Colman Smith's original 1909 illustrations for the Rider-Waite-Smith deck. It maintains the classic symbolism and compositions, making it fully compatible with traditional RWS interpretations and guidebooks.
What is the art style of the Pop Art Tarot?
The deck features a pop art aesthetic, characterized by bold, flat, and highly saturated colors applied to the classic Rider-Waite-Smith line art. This creates a vibrant, modern, and graphic look that reinterprets the traditional imagery.
Is this deck suitable for beginners?
Yes, the Pop Art Tarot is suitable for beginners. Because it retains the core Rider-Waite-Smith imagery and symbolism, new readers can easily use it with any standard RWS learning resources. The vibrant and engaging artwork may also make the learning process more enjoyable.
